Latest Patents
Frieder Helm holds a patent for a liposomal formulation designed for the oral hepatic delivery of drugs. This invention relates to liposomal compositions that include liposomes containing tetraether lipids (TELs) and the lipopeptide Myr-HBVpreS/2-48 (Myrcludex B). The patent outlines the uses of these compositions for the prevention or treatment of hepatic disorders and for the oral delivery of therapeutic and diagnostic agents. He has 1 patent to his name.
